  • Abstract
    In order to facilitate the rapid development of economy and excellent performance intelligent monitoring and control system, a scheme based on the AC asynchronous motor, inverters and intelligent fuzzy control is proposed. A common monitoring and control terminals is designed, and on this basis developed a prototype system of fuzzy control. Smart terminal using fuzzy control algorithm control the start, stop and speed change of the motor by inverters. Combination of work site and artificial experience, enter the corresponding parameters, a smart measurement and control system can be quickly and easily build. The system has been successfully applied in regulation environment of livestock and poultry, and has achieved remarkable results. The common fuzzy control terminal has great promotion value in the future.
